How to search a particular string in whole schema? Oracle SELECT Select: Query Data From One or More Columns of a Table The syntax of Oracle ALTER TABLE MODIFY statement is as follows: SQL ALTER TABLE table_name MODIFY column_name modificiation; Here, table_name - It is the name of table in which we want to make changes. In this context, COLUMN_VALUE is not a pseudocolumn, but an actual column name. Select all table name postgresql - compsovet.com The best answers are voted up and rise to the top, Not the answer you're looking for? 3) subquery. JSON_VALUE() and JSON_TABLE(COLUMNSNUMBER) honour N - Oracle SELECT first value from 3 tables that is not null, Select data based on records created_at column, Oracle PLSQL validate a row and insert each cell value of row as a new row with validation results in another table oracle, Separate a column into its components based on another table, split one column into two columns based on it's value using t/sql, Select query with custom column and value of other column, Query to divide each column value to two categories: [Common , Not_Common]. COLUMN_VALUE Pseudocolumn - docs.oracle.com How Do I Query Multiple Rows In Sql Of 2022 - Wiki How Do Oracle IN: Test whether a Value Matches a List of Values or a Subquery To learn more, see our tips on writing great answers.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site, Learn more about Stack Overflow the company, Oracle Select Query based on a column value, Fighting to balance identity and anonymity on the web(3) (Ep. Does Donald Trump have any official standing in the Republican Party right now? . data_precision - length - for NUMBER - decimal digits; for FLOAT - binary digits. Third, the SELECT clause chose the columns that should be returned. For eg if my ERROR_CODE column has the following values, How can i fetch all records which has the ERROR_CODE in the range say 7000-7999. or ALL_. Can I get my private pilots licence? Why Does Braking to a Complete Stop Feel Exponentially Harder Than Slowing Down? select * from dba_tab_columns a, dba_tables b where a.table_name = b.table_name and a.owner = b.owner and a.data_type in ( 'NUMBER', 'VARCHAR2', 'NCHAR', 'CHAR' ) and b.owner not in ( 'SYS', 'SYSTEM' ); The consequence of using the classic TO_NUMBER (and thereby honouring NLS_NUMERIC_CHARACTERS) is even worse when using JSON_TABLE() and defining NUMBER-columns: then it could happen that no data is returned at all. if number =12 How to get rid of complex terms in the given expression and rewrite it as a real function? select table_name from dba_tab_columns where column_name='THE_COLUMN_YOU_LOOK_FOR'; If you don't have DBA privileges, you can try this: select table_name from all_tab_columns where column_name='THE_COLUMN_YOU_LOOK_FOR'; Share Improve this answer Follow edited Jan 17, 2019 at 15:52 tinlyx 3,035 7 36 56 answered Jan 17, 2019 at 13:52 Sello Hlabeli 1 Longer answer: here's a script I used to demonstrate several different features of nested tables. See query at bottom.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. rev2022.11.10.43025. How to Find the Row That Has the Maximum Value for a Column in Oracle And my where clauses are, data_type IN ('CHAR','VARCHAR2','NUMBER'), May I have your help for building the query. XMLTABLE for information on that function, table_collection_expression ::= for information on the TABLE collection expression, ALTER TABLE examples in "Nested Tables: Examples". You can use a union to select from two tables like follows: SELECT * FROM TABLE_A WHERE number = 12 AND {other conditions} UNION SELECT * FROM TABLE_B WHERE number != 12 AND {other conditions} Share Improve this answer Follow answered Jul 22, 2020 at 23:53 Malcolm Byrne 1 Add a comment Your Answer SELECT * FROM ALL_TAB_COLS WHERE TABLE_NAME = 'my_table'; -- Available to user 4 SELECT * FROM DBA_TAB_COLS WHERE TABLE_NAME = 'my_table'; -- All schemas 5 6 -- Columns from all tables in a schema (adapt with USER_., DBA_. If the HAVING clause is present, it eliminates groups that do not satisfy the . And now when I look a bit more closely, you don't need DBA_TABLES there. You must include the column in a BREAK command with the SKIP PAGE action. Select Column Values from all the tables of database ORACLE Do conductor fill and continual usage wire ampacity derate stack? . between and the >< symbols will use the sort value. The variable name cannot contain a pound sign (#). how to GROUP BY on specific column and COUNT() the other columns? oracle'da tablo stunlarndan alnan deerlerden bir JSON dizesi nasl oluturulur. How did Space Shuttles get off the NASA Crawler? In this context, COLUMN_VALUE is not a pseudocolumn, but an actual column name. Below is an example of this: Oracle SQL Query to Select Rows Where Column Value Appears . The SELECT statement is so named because the typical first word of the query construct is SELECT. NGINX access logs from single page application, Distance from Earth to Mars at time of November 8, 2022 lunar eclipse maximum. Or if you want to user DBA_* tables, you can use. I have a Oracle table, where along with other columns there is an column named ERROR_CODE VARCHAR2. 3 SELECT column FROM ( SELECT column FROM table ORDER BY dbms_random.value ) WHERE rownum <= 1000 1000 How to Select Rows with Max Value for a Column in Oracle SQL To issue an Oracle Flashback Query using the flashback_query_clause, you must have the READ or SELECT privilege on the objects in the select list. Use NEW_VALUE to display column values or the date in the top title. Columns. data_type - column datatype. Short answer: COLUMN_VALUE. FROM table_name; In this SELECT statement: First, specify the table name from which you want to query the data. Selecting Table Data - Oracle select Query on Table B. Find centralized, trusted content and collaborate around the technologies you use most. Step 1 - Find Max Value for Groups We can skip all the way to the end to get the query that you need. What references should I use for how Fae look in urban shadows games? oracle calculated column in select - isidora.digevo.com I would like to run a query on table based on the value of Number column which is common in both tables. Software in Silicon (Sample Code & Resources). For example, the following two statements are equivalent, and the output for both shows COLUMN_VALUE as the name of the column being returned: In the context of a TABLE collection expression, the value returned is the data type of the collection element. Query to Find Table and Column Name by using a value - oracle-tech It only takes a minute to sign up. SELECT t.COLUMN_VALUE FROM TABLE (phone_list (phone (1,2,3))) p, TABLE (p.COLUMN_VALUE) t; COLUMN_VALUE ------------ 1 2 3 The keyword COLUMN_VALUE is also the name that Oracle Database generates for the scalar value of an inner nested table without a column or attribute name, as shown in the example that follows. data_scale - digits to right of decimal . Using the TABLE Operator with Locally Defined Types in PL/SQL Stack Overflow for Teams is moving to its own domain! In this example, Oracle evaluates the clauses in the following order: FROM WHERE and SELECT First, the FROM clause specified the table for querying data. Followed the IN operator is a list of comma-separated values to test for a match. oracle'da tablo stunlarndan alnan deerlerden bir JSON dizesi nasl When you refer to an XMLTable construct without the COLUMNS clause, or when you use the TABLE collection expression to refer to a scalar nested table type, the database returns a virtual table with a single column. This is probably a simple where clause but I want to say, from columnX (which is datetime) I want all rows where just the year = 2010. so: select * from mytable where Columnx = When you start the service, database tables, on which HeatWave queries are run, have to be loaded to the HeatWave cluster memory. The expression is any valid expression, which can be a column of a table that you want to match. I hope and surfed in our forums and google to find the Table Name and Column Name by having a value(Number/String). In this case, though, since it looks like an integer it can be treated like one. COLUMN - Oracle The users performing inserts against the table must have select privilege on the sequence, as well as insert privilege on the table. The subquery returns a result set of one column . Can my Uni see the downloads from discord app when I use their wifi? Thanks for your answer @Dennis de Jong. Thanks!! When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. I have a windows service application written in .net 3.5 that needs to know when data is added or modified into an Oracle Database. XMLTABLE for information on that function, table_collection_expression::= for information on the TABLE collection expression, ALTER TABLE examples in Nested Tables: Examples, Appendix C in Oracle Database Globalization Support Guide for the collation derivation rules for values of the COLUMN_VALUE pseudocolumn, Creating a Table: Multilevel Collection Example. "Creating a Table: Multilevel Collection Example". Table B ( SNO, Number,FullName..) By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. And requirement is still not clear yet. In the context of XMLTable, the value returned is of data type XMLType. Your question isn't 100% clear, but I'm guessing that you're asking to have that query you posted fixed. The following statements create the two levels of nested tables illustrated in "Creating a Table: Multilevel Collection Example" to show the uses of COLUMN_VALUE in this context: The next statement uses COLUMN_VALUE to select from the phone type: In a nested type, you can use the COLUMN_VALUE pseudocolumn in both the select list and the TABLE collection expression: The keyword COLUMN_VALUE is also the name that Oracle Database generates for the scalar value of an inner nested table without a column or attribute name, as shown in the example that follows. and my query as follows, select a.owner, c.column_name, c.data_type, c.owner, c.table_name, where a.owner NOT IN ('SYS','SYSTEM') and, where c.owner NOT IN ('SYS','SYSTEM') and. Select Query on Table A The Moon turns into a black hole of the same mass -- what happens next? oracle list columns in schema Code Example - codegrepper.com Oracle Select Query based on a column value When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Asking for help, clarification, or responding to other answers. SELECT city, temperature FROM weather ORDER BY city; Correct answer is (c) SELECT city, temperature FROM weather ORDER BY temperature; To explain I would say: SELECT column_name, aggregate_function(column_name) FROM table_name WHERE column_name operator value GROUP BY column_name HAVING aggregate_function(column_name) operator value ORDER BY . Is // really a stressed schwa, appearing only in stressed syllables? For a SELECT you can either, use a CASE expression and whitelist the column names: select column1, CASE :P31_LIST WHEN 'column1' THEN column1 WHEN 'column2' THEN column2 WHEN 'column3' THEN column3 ELSE NULL END AS value from my_table. Viewed 1000+ times The output of my query should give. i replied to similar post here How to search a particular string in whole schema? This is probably a simple where clause but I want to say, from columnX (which is datetime) I want all rows where just the year = 2010. so: select * from mytable where Columnx = The first two columns each use a specific color (the first with an English name, the second with an RGB value).
Bachelor Of Science In Banking And Finance Job, Ftce K-6 Passing Score, William Marshall Knight, Lil Uzi Vert Concert Near Me, Specialized Sirrus 2018,